Hydrangea 80 your Endless Summer is beautiful. Have you been fertilizing it? My ES has grown, but hasn't bloomed. How much sun exposure does yours get? I've been trying to figure out what I'm doing wrong.
I planted my Endless summer next to an evergreen bush because they like acidic soil. I fertilize every 2-3 weeks with Miracle Grow for acid-loving plants. I have also started spraying the leaves with Messenger which has helped the entire plant grow (before all I was getting were blooms and no growth!) It gets shade all morning, some afternoon sun, and then shade again. It likes fertilizer A LOT! I also water it every day really well. My hydrangeas are my only plants that I water almost every day!
